Modify form field properties in Acrobat

You can access Acrobat form field properties only when you are in editing mode (by choosing Forms > Edit Form In Acrobat or Tools > Advanced Editing > Select Object Tool). You can change the properties for a multiple form fields at a time.

Note: Some basic options can be changed on the Properties bar, which you can open or hide by choosing View > Toolbars > Properties Bar.
  1. Open the Properties dialog box using one of the following methods:
    • To edit a single form field, double-click it or right-click/Control-click it and choose Properties.

    • To edit multiple form fields, select the fields that you want to edit, right-click/Control-click one of the selected fields, and choose Properties.

  2. Make changes to the properties on each of the available tabs, as needed.
  3. Click Close to apply and save the changed properties to the selected form fields.

If you select form fields that have different property values, some options in the Properties dialog box are not available. Otherwise, changes to the available options are applied to all selected form fields.

To avoid accidental changes to the form field, select Locked in the lower left corner of the Properties dialog box before you close it. To unlock, click the check box again.
